Two different style seat belt manufactures were used on Chevy and GM from 1988-1999.

TRW style belts are typically in 88-94, Bendix and bendix style-allied are typically in 88-99, but there are exceptions and overlaps and possible seat belt change overs from previous owners.

See last two pictures for comparison only, one way to tell what you have is to look at the male end, the inside bendix hole will be more rectangular and the TRW hole is more square.

TRW and Bendix seat belts will NOT work together (they will not latch together).

Keep in mind that 50% of the time that the extended cab seat belts are TRW brand and that the regular cab seat belts are bendix 95% of the time.

The second way to tell is the TRW female head is always stamped with a TRW in big letters near the bottom of the head itself only on one side, the bendix may or may not be stamped with a bendix name.

Hyundai confirms luxury Genesis Brand to take on Lexus & Infiniti

Tue, 25 Oct 2011

Hyundai are planning to launch the Genesis Brand (Hyundai Veloster pictured) The rise and rise of Hyundai (and Kia too) has lead to speculation for some time that the next stage in their evolution is a proper luxury brand to take on Infiniti and Lexus, and it’s now confirmed that Hyundai will be launching the ‘Genesis’ brand within two years. Not to be confused with the ‘Not for the UK’ Hyundai Genesis, the Genesis brand will be a range of cars from Hyundai offering real competition for the luxury brands from Nissan and Toyota, but with a dose of Hyundai pricing and warranty thrown in to the mix. Hyundai’s product manager in Australia – Roland Rivero - has come out and confirmed that the Genesis brand is in  the making and will initially – at least in Australia – offer two RWD cars.

General Motors' R&D chief Larry Burns, PR boss Steve Harris set to retire

Thu, 16 Jul 2009

General Motors, following through with plans to shake up management after exiting bankruptcy, said r&d chief Larry Burns and public relations boss Steve Harris will retire. Burns, 58, will be replaced by Alan Taub. Harris, who came out of retirement more than three years ago, will yield his job to Chris Preuss, 43, vice president in charge of General Motors Europe communications.
